All Smiles For Islip's Exciting First Day Of School
Commack Road Elementary School celebrated the first day of school with a second-grade parade.

ISLIP, NY - From Islip School District: The first day of classes in Islip arrived on Sept. 5, with students in the district’s high school, middle school and Commack Road, Maud S. Sherwood and Wing elementary schools arriving to begin a new year of learning.
“I am so proud to be the principal of Islip Middle School, where the kids bring the innocence and joy that can easily be overlooked in our fast-paced world,” said Timothy Martin. “I am looking forward to an exciting year.”
“It was a great first day for the students at Sherwood,” said Principal Chad Walerstein. “It was nice to see all the new and returning smiling faces as they entered, and it was even better to hear students say how great their day went as they left for the day.”
